MEMO — Discount Policy for Large Deals

To: Sales Leads, Brightlock Software

Effective immediately, discounts on deals above 250 seats follow a fixed ladder: up to 10% at lead discretion, 10–18% with regional approval, anything beyond requires sign-off from Priya in Commercial Finance. Stacking promotional credits on top of ladder discounts is not permitted. Quotes already issued are honored through month-end. Log every approved exception in the deal desk tracker. The reasoning behind these thresholds is noted below.

board note of kageg-bahof: The renewal with Holwynax Holdings closes at $2 million a year, 5 percent below the last contract. Project Ulaath slips by two quarters because of the supplier delay.

MEMO — Pricing Update: Quellis Line

Hi all — quick heads-up for sales leads before the town hall. We're adjusting Quellis pricing next month: the entry tier drops slightly to fend off Braxon's discounting push, while the Pro and Atlas tiers get a modest lift backed by the new service bundle. Net effect should be margin-neutral, maybe better. Hold quotes longer than thirty days until the new sheets land. Keep this inside the team for now. The confidential note on the broader plan sits just below.

confidential, kagup-bafog: Fraaxax Group is in early talks to buy Soroxox Group for about $343.8 million. The Olidor launch date is June 14, and nothing goes to the press before then. Legal wants the Aldmirek Logistics term sheet signed before July 23.

# Data Stores — Autocomplete Index

The Quillfinder autocomplete index has been slow since the Tornquist catalog import doubled term counts. Queries over 80ms come from the `suggest_terms` table; the trigram index there is bloated and needs a REINDEX after every bulk load. A nightly job handles this, but it silently skips when replication lag exceeds 30s — check `maint_log` if latency spikes. Future maintainers: do not add columns to `suggest_terms` without rebuilding stats. To inspect the index directly, connect with the string below.

replica DSN, kajep-yahag: mssql://praok_svc:iF@db-8d68.plorvaio.local:5432/eliion